AWSSaaS

AWS Development for SaaS

Expert fractional CTO services combining AWS expertise with deep SaaS industry knowledge. Build compliant, scalable solutions that meet SaaS-specific requirements.

Why AWS for SaaS?

AWS Strengths

  • Most comprehensive service offering of any cloud
  • Mature and reliable with strong SLAs
  • Global presence with regions worldwide
  • Strong security and compliance certifications

SaaS Requirements

  • Scaling infrastructure to handle rapid user growth
  • Multi-tenant architecture and data isolation
  • API design and third-party integrations
  • SOC 2 Type II compliance for enterprise customers

AWS Use Cases in SaaS

Auto-scaling SaaS infrastructure

Multi-tenant data isolation

Cost-optimized cloud deployment

Architecture Patterns for SaaS

Pattern 1

Multi-account strategy for tenant isolation

Pattern 2

Auto-scaling groups for variable load

Pattern 3

Global CDN for performance optimization

Performance

Use CloudFront for static assets, implement proper caching, right-size instances with Compute Optimizer, use Reserved Instances or Savings Plans.

Security

Enable GuardDuty, configure Security Hub, implement WAF, use Secrets Manager, enable CloudTrail, implement proper encryption at rest and in transit.

Scaling

AWS scales to any size. Start simple with managed services, add complexity only as needed. Consider serverless for variable workloads, containers for consistent workloads.

SaaS Compliance with AWS

Required Compliance

SOC 2 Type II
GDPR
CCPA
ISO 27001

Implementation Considerations

  • Data minimization and purpose limitation
  • Right to erasure implementation
  • Consent management systems
  • Data portability features

Complementary Technologies for SaaS

frontend

ReactVue.jsNext.js

backend

Node.jsPython/DjangoRuby on Rails

infrastructure

AWSGoogle CloudKubernetes

Recommended Team Structure

Dedicated DevOps/SRE roles become important at scale. Small teams can share AWS responsibility, larger orgs need platform engineering teams.

Timeline: Initial setup: 2-4 weeks, Full architecture: 2-4 months, Migration: 3-12 months
Budget: $20,000-$100,000 for architecture and setup (plus ongoing AWS costs)

Success Story: AWS

Series A SaaS spending $45K/month on AWS

Challenge

AWS costs growing faster than revenue. No visibility into cost drivers. Infrastructure unreliable with frequent outages.

Solution

Fractional CTO audited architecture, implemented right-sizing, restructured to use Reserved Instances, added proper monitoring and auto-scaling.

Result

Reduced monthly AWS costs by 55% to $20K. Improved uptime from 99.2% to 99.95%. Implemented proper disaster recovery.

Timeline: 2 months

Need AWS Expertise for Your SaaS Business?

Get expert fractional CTO guidance combining AWS technical excellence with deep SaaS industry knowledge and compliance expertise.